Transaction 8570228bec5c23c522ac072438dd27f71af5f7ff3749eb1ceef6d84f79a46195

3 Input
2 Outputs
  • 8570228bec5c23c522ac072438dd27f71af5f7ff3749eb1ceef6d84f79a46195:0
  • value  3007895
    address  3CMQVehhN1Bm3nwq4fCEeZiRpUAXDqXFAF
  • 8570228bec5c23c522ac072438dd27f71af5f7ff3749eb1ceef6d84f79a46195:1
  • value  646386
    address  bc1quws8dlcwkdk0lw66704sjg5q2j4n4685f6as0f